  6. I was on clear liquids for 2 weeks, moved to puréed for another 2 weeks and then soft food diet now until 12 weeks out (I am currently at 9 weeks out).

    I was able to do the powders?utm_source=BariatricPal&utm_medium=Affiliate&utm_campaign=CommentLink" target="_ad" data-id="1" >unjury chicken broth already at the hospital the day after I was sleeved. It's available online. Just make sure your Water is less than 140 degrees or it lumps.

    I also did a lot of sugar free Popsicles and Jello. This all counted toward my daily liquids.
